Things to do in Greenville?
Greenville, South Carolina is a vibrant city located in the southeastern region of the United States. Home to attractions such as Falls Park and Cleveland Park, visitors can enjoy outdoor activities and nature when visiting Greenville. There are also plenty of museums, galleries, shops, restaurants and performance venues such as the Peace Center for Performing Arts and The Children’s Museum of the Upstate. For entertainment, visitors can explore downtown shopping districts along with movie theaters and live music clubs.
